The 2010 Second Language Research Forum will be held October 14-17 at the Riggs Alumni Center of the University of Maryland. In concert with the theme “Reconsidering SLA research: Dimensions and Directions”, this year’s SLRF conference will bring together relevant theories and research methodology from various disciplines that deepen our understanding of SLA and its application to real world needs.
To this end, we are soliciting papers and posters that investigate SLA from a variety of perspectives that add to our collective understanding of SLA in theory, research, and practice. Abstracts will be considered in any area of L2 research including, but not limited to:
Formal approaches to SLA
Cognitive approaches to SLA
Socio-cultural approaches to SLA
Neurocognitive approaches to SLA
L2 psycholinguistics
Instructional SLA, classroom research, and pedagogy
L2 assessment and research methodology
Bilingualism and heritage language acquisition
Proposals are invited for individual papers and posters. All abstracts for papers and posters should be limited to 300 words.
Paper Presentations:
Paper presentations will be 20 minutes long, followed by a 10-minute discussion period.
Poster Presentations:
Posters are intended for one-on-one discussion of research. Presenters with work in progress are encouraged to consider submitting abstracts for poster presentation.
